Job Description
|
| Vashon Island Fire and Rescue provides a variety of services including fire suppression, emergency medical serice, water rescue, high-to-low angle rope rescue, hazardous materials response, and public safety education. Vashon Island has one station staffed 24 hours and four volunteer stations. Career Firefighters and Paramedics work a four-platoon schedule with one day on, one day off, one day on, five days off, plus 14 debit pays per year and three 12 -hour debits for training. Vashon Island Fire & Rescue covers Vashon and Maury Islands, an area of 45 square miles with 55 miles of shoreline. There are appoximately 1,600 incidnt responses annually. Job Requirements
|
Age 18
Additional Requirement : Candidates must be a graduate of a state fire training academy or a firefighter recruit academy with training to Firefighter 1 level. IFSAC Firefighter 1 certification is preferred. Current WA state Emergency Medical Technician certification is required. IFSAC Firefighter 1 certification is required within one year of hire. Preference points will be added to the final score of current VIFR volunteer members in good standing. Preference points will be added to applicants with IFSAC Firefighter 1 certification.
